Odisha private bus owners’ association calls for indefinite stir from October 10

Bhubaneswar: All Odisha Bus Owners’ Association decided to go on an indefinite strike across the State from October 10, in its General Body meeting held in Bhubaneswar today.

According to the association sources, the strike has been called opposing the LAccMI scheme of the Odisha Government, which is to be launched in Malkangiri on October 2 and a 24-hour cease-wheel (Chaka-Bandh) agitation will also be carried out in undivided Koraput district on the same day.

Accordingly, private buses will not run from Koraput, Malkangiri, Jeypore, and Nabarangpur districts to outside places and vice versa.

Notably, the association had a meeting with the State government earlier in the day. The strike will be carried out, in case the demands of the outfit are not met.

In a letter to general secretary of the association, Transport Commissioner-cum-Chairman of the State Transport Authority (STA)-ODISHA in Cuttack wrote, “As discussed in the meeting on 10.08.2023, it has been decided that all RTOS will hold meetings with the concerned Bus Associations in their jurisdiction and in case of clash of timings of buses of private operators with LAccMI Bus, STA resolutions regarding grant of permit will be followed.”
